Abstract | The longitudinal momentum (p(//)) distributions of fragments after one-proton removal and reaction cross sections (sigma R) for several N = 10 isotones at intermediate energy (similar to 70A MeV) have been measured simultaneously at the RIken Projectile fragment Separator (RIPS). p(//) was measured using a direct time-of-flight (TOF) technique, while sigma(R) was determined using a transmission method. An enhanced sigma(R) is observed for Al-23 comparing with its neighbors. The p(//) distribution for Mg-22 fragments from Al-23 one-proton removal reaction has been obtained for the first time. The experimental data are discussed within a Few Body Glauber (FBG) framework. Analysis of p// indicates a dominant d-wave component in the ground state of Al-23. This agrees with recent experimental results. We also suggest the possibility of an enlarged Mg-22 core for proton-rich nucleus Al-23. |
